Black Cottage Hawke's Bay Syrah 2021

Black Cottage Hawke's Bay Syrah 2021

"It's splendidly fruited and enticing on the nose with Black Doris plum, blueberry, rich floral and warm spice aromas, followed by a succulent palate that's plump and flavoursome. Beautifully framed by finely infused tannins, finishing long and delectable. At its best: now to 2029" Sam Kim, Wine Orbit, Jun 2024

"Great colour and bouquet with dark ruby and purples, black currant and soft licorice spice, baked plum and a fine layer of pepper dust. Dry with medium weight and intensity, flavours of dark berries and spice, a light smoky wood quality and textures from firm-ish tannins and acid line. Developing nicely with best drinking from 2025 through 2030+" Cameron Douglas, Master Sommelier, Jun 2024

With bright crimson hues, this delicious Syrah is bursting with blue fruits, plum, violets, and spice. There’s a lovely earthiness on the palate with notes of raspberry, florals and just a touch of black pepper coming through. Plush tannins and a robust mouthfeel round off the finish.

Sourced from New Zealand's premium red wine region, the grapes for this Syrah were harvested predominantly from the Gimblett Gravels sub-region of Hawke’s Bay. The wine was matured with French oak for 10 months.

Food Pairing: Pair with braised beef and barbecued vegetables.
